Author: Laborde, Alexandre de, (1774-1842) Publisher: l'imprimerie de Pierre Didot l'ainé City: París Year 1806-1820 Document type: Guides and Travel guides Subject: Art (general) Library: Museo Nacional de Arte Romano Abstract: Four-volume work published in 1806, 1811, 1812 and 1820 in Paris, including a large number of engravings of cities, landscapes and monuments of Spain, in particular of Catalonia (1st volume), Valencia and Extremadura (2nd volume), Andalusia (3rd volume) and Castile and Aragon (4th volume). Author: Museu d'Art Contemporani de Barcelona ; Guasch y Homs, Francisco; Batlle Ametlió, Esteban Publisher: Junta de Museos de Barcelona City: Barcelona Year 1926 Document type: Catalogs Subject: Art (general) Library: UAB Abstract: Catalogue of the Museum of Contemporary Art of Barcelona, published in 1926. This publication showcases contemporary art pieces from the collection of the Junta de Museus, displayed at the Palace of Fine Arts. It features an alphabetical index of artists and provides detailed listings of paintings and sculptures housed within the museum. Id: 742
Author: Museu d'Art de Catalunya ; Junta de Museos de Barcelona Publisher: Museu d'Art de Catalunya City: Barcelona Year 1936 Document type: Catalogs Subject: Art (general) Library: UAB Abstract: Catalogue of the Art Museum of Catalonia, issued in 1936 at its new location in the National Palace on Montjuïc. This initial section of the catalogue encompasses works from the Romanesque, Gothic, Renaissance, and Baroque art periods. Id: 741
